At Wickhams, our Black Belt Program is designed as a long-term journey, not a rush to rank. The program typically takes around four years to complete, sometimes longer depending on attendance. That’s intentional. We focus on consistency, growth, and enjoying the learning process, not just chasing belts.

Progressing through the program is about developing skill, character, and commitment. Rank matters, but the journey matters more.

Skills for Life – Children’s Program

For our younger students, learning continues beyond the dojo. With the support of parents and guardians, children are encouraged to apply what they learn at home and in everyday situations.

Our Skills for Life program uses a simple monthly checklist. When students apply these skills consistently, they are recognised with a certificate at the end of each month. It’s a practical, positive way to reinforce good habits and personal growth.

Assistant Instructor Program

Leadership development is a powerful part of a child’s growth. Our Assistant Instructor pathway gives students the opportunity to build confidence, responsibility, and communication skills.

Students can begin this journey through our leadership program, progressing through different levels from junior assistant to mentor and coach. Once a student reaches Green Belt level, they can attend Assistant Instructor classes, which run once per term.

After completing these sessions, students can begin assisting in regular classes, supporting instructors and acting as positive role models for younger members.

Fight Team

Our Fight Team includes members who choose to compete in tournaments, from forms and kata to sparring competitions. Students train directly with the Head Instructor in preparation for events.

Competition dates are listed on the calendar, and while we encourage students to compete at least once during their training journey, our focus is never just on winning.

For us, competition is about participation, personal growth, and learning from the experience. Every contest is an opportunity to build resilience, confidence, and self-belief.
